Origin & History
Amylase (EC 3.2.1.1) is a natural digestive enzyme that catalyzes the hydrolysis of complex carbohydrates into simpler sugars, primarily maltose and glucose. Produced endogenously in human salivary glands and the pancreas, it is fundamental for efficient carbohydrate metabolism. This enzyme is also widely available as a dietary supplement to support digestion, particularly for individuals with high carbohydrate intake or digestive sensitivities.
“While the enzyme amylase itself is a modern biochemical identification, its functional role in carbohydrate breakdown has been implicitly recognized for centuries through traditional food preparation methods like malting, fermentation, and cooking. These practices, found across diverse cultures, inherently leverage amylase activity to make starches more digestible and palatable.”Traditional Medicine

Preparation & Dosage
Common Forms
Available as capsules, powders, or integrated into multi-enzyme digestive blends.
Dosage
Typically 10,000–50,000 USP units per meal, adjusted based on individual needs and dietary carbohydrate intake.
Timing
Best taken with carbohydrate-rich meals to optimize digestive efficiency and reduce discomfort.
Application
Particularly useful for individuals with digestive sensitivities to starches or those consuming high-carbohydrate diets.
Nutritional Profile
- Enzymatic Action: Catalyzes the hydrolysis of alpha-1,4 glycosidic bonds in starch and glycogen.
- Substrates: Amylose, amylopectin, glycogen.
- Products: Maltose, glucose, and dextrins.
- Key Role: Essential for efficient carbohydrate metabolism and energy production.

Frequently Asked Questions
What is Amylase?
Amylase is a natural digestive enzyme that your body uses to break down starches and complex carbohydrates into simple sugars for energy. Taking it as a supplement can help reduce bloating and discomfort after eating carb-heavy meals.
How much Amylase should I take?
Dosage is measured in activity units, not milligrams, and typically ranges from 10,000 to 50,000 USP units per meal. It's best taken just before or during a meal containing carbohydrates for maximum effectiveness.
Can Amylase help with gas and bloating?
Yes, by efficiently breaking down starches, amylase reduces the amount of undigested carbohydrates reaching the large intestine. This minimizes fermentation by gut bacteria, which is a primary cause of gas and bloating.
